The classes at Mei Quan Academy of Taiji consist of a combination of warm-up and conditioning exercises, Tai Chi Form, Qigong, and partner work. The Tai Chi forms taught at the academy are flowing sequences of movements that typically last between five and twenty minutes. The beginners' course focuses on learning the Beijing 24-Step Short Form, which provides a solid foundation for progressing to the full Long Form in later classes.
Students at Mei Quan Academy also learn various Qigong exercises, including the famous Eight Pieces of Silk Brocade sequence and the 28-Step Qigong set. These exercises, along with Standing Stake meditation, contribute to improved health and increased awareness of the body's energy. Additionally, partner exercises such as Sticking, Yielding, and Centering are utilised to enhance balance, coordination, spatial awareness, and sensitivity.
